450 jobs to go at Norwich Union
Posted September 15th, 2006 by Anonymous
Norwich Union have just announced a swathe of job cuts incluing 450 in York.
This'll have a huge impact locally, and follows on from major job losses at Nestle, British Sugar, and Fastline (one of the out-sourced rail depots).
Local Trade Unionists are discussing possible courses of action and perhaps the need for a broader campaign (through Trades Council?) over the big picture - will try to keep IndyMedia updated.
